在计算机科学的世界里,编程是探索未知、实现梦想的钥匙。C语言作为一种历史悠久、功能强大的编程语言,在计算机领域有着举足轻重的地位。本文将以马刺C语言编程为例,探讨编程之美,解锁计算机奥秘。

一、马刺C语言编程概述

马刺C语言编程是指利用C语言进行编程,以实现计算机程序的开发。C语言具有丰富的库函数、灵活的数据结构和高效的执行效率,使其在操作系统、嵌入式系统、编译器等领域有着广泛的应用。

二、马刺C语言编程的特点

马刺C语言编程探索编程之美,计算机奥秘

1. 简洁明了:C语言语法简洁,易于阅读和理解,有利于提高编程效率。

2. 高效执行:C语言编译器生成的目标代码执行效率高,能够充分发挥硬件性能。

3. 丰富的库函数:C语言提供了丰富的库函数,方便开发者快速实现各种功能。

4. 良好的移植性:C语言编写的程序具有良好的移植性,可以在不同的操作系统和硬件平台上运行。

5. 灵活的数据结构:C语言支持多种数据结构,如数组、结构体、指针等,方便开发者进行数据处理。

三、马刺C语言编程的应用领域

1. 操作系统:C语言是操作系统开发的重要工具,如Linux内核就是采用C语言编写的。

2. 嵌入式系统:C语言在嵌入式系统开发中占据主导地位,如ARM架构的嵌入式设备。

3. 编译器:C语言编写的编译器具有高效、稳定的特点,如GCC编译器。

4. 游戏开发:C语言在游戏开发领域具有广泛的应用,如《星际争霸》、《英雄联盟》等游戏。

5. 图形处理:C语言在图形处理领域具有很高的效率,如OpenGL和DirectX等图形库。

四、马刺C语言编程的学习方法

1. 理论与实践相结合:学习C语言不仅要掌握语法,还要注重实践,通过编写程序来提高编程能力。

2. 查阅资料:遇到问题时,要及时查阅相关资料,如C语言教程、库函数手册等。

3. 参加社区交流:加入C语言编程社区,与其他开发者交流心得,共同进步。

4. 模拟实战:通过模拟实战项目,锻炼编程能力,提高解决问题的能力。

马刺C语言编程是一门具有广泛应用的编程语言,通过学习马刺C语言编程,我们能够更好地理解计算机的奥秘,探索编程之美。在未来的学习和发展中,让我们继续努力,成为一名优秀的C语言程序员。